Topic: MVTools2 и все-все-все

Вышла новая версия MVTools2.
2.5.11.2 beta (20.03.2011 by Fizick)

MCompensate: исправлен крах со слишком малыми npad, vpad (спасибо '-Vit-')

Для SVP вроде бы не актуально, но специально еще не сравнивал.

Документация и загрузка MVTools2

------------------

InterFrame. Автор: SubJunk

Еще один скриптовый плагин Avisynth, рассчитывающий промежуточные кадры.
Имеет 5 значений скорости работы (Ultra Fast, Very Fast, Fast, Medium, Placebo) и 3 варианта плавности (Film, Smooth, Animation).

Предлагаю ознакомиться и попробовать.
Вероятно, можно будет почерпнуть идеи для будущих версий SVP.

Документация InterFrame
Пошаговая инструкция к применению: MeGUI + AviSynth 2.6

Re: MVTools2 и все-все-все

Навскидку проверил наши тестовые ролики:
1. Скорость значительно ниже (если я правильно юзал).
2. Артефачит не больше наших качественных.
3. На цунами плавность не отключается smile

Re: MVTools2 и все-все-все

Ознакомился. Новых идей там нет, кроме:
1. pel-клип делается  с участием функции EEDI2 (что это?)
2. в MAnalyse используется SATD вместо SAD

Ну и еще там Recalculate до блоков 4*4. Так что сравнивать с нами надо при блоках 8*8 и включенном "уточнении".

Главная идея - кол-во настроек, равное одной  big_smile

Re: MVTools2 и все-все-все

InterFrame развивается. Текущая версия 1.3.1 от 01.04.2011.
Теперь настроек уже больше одной. А именно: их теперь две. Отдельно настраивается скорость-качество, отдельно - эффект плавности.
5 значений скорости работы (Ultra Fast, Very Fast, Fast, Medium, Placebo) и 3 варианта плавности (Film, Smooth, Animation).

Подробнее см. документацию InterFrame
Обновилась пошаговая инструкция к применению InterFrame: MeGUI + AviSynth 2.6

Re: MVTools2 и все-все-все

Настройка "плавность" регулирует размер блока (!).
Плюс, там теперь два (!!) пересчета векторов, только с минимальным радиусом поиска (=1).

Например, при плавности = "smooth":
1. Поиск векторов для блоков 16*16
2. Пересчет их в блоки 8*8
3. Пересчет п.2 в блоки 4*4

Все с параметрами по-умолчанию.

Re: MVTools2 и все-все-все

Насчет EEDI2. Есть более быстрые варианты EEDI3 и NNEDI3 (автор:tritical).
Разницу можно визуально сравнить интерактивно на страничке: Video resize methods comparison. Я насчитал 17 алгоритмов, не считая исходник и алгоритм ближайшего соседа (Nearest Neighdour).
MVTools для pel-клипа применяет резкую интерполяцию, подобно Lanczos.
Почувствуйте разницу wink

Re: MVTools2 и все-все-все

Так и на кой черт он этот eedi2 использует?  hmm
Хотя можно спросить у автора smile

8 (edited by Noweol 06-04-2011 09:10:59)

Re: MVTools2 и все-все-все

Video Enhancer и NNEDI3 - бесспорные финалисты. Video Enhancer даже получше будет. Но что-то странно мне - нет разницы между bicubic и Lanczos, хотя по моему тесту разница была и ещё какая!

Re: MVTools2 и все-все-все

Да и вообще, в данном случае способы ресайза суперклипа очень мало влияют на финальный результат.

Re: MVTools2 и все-все-все

Да и вообще, в данном случае способы ресайза суперклипа очень мало влияют на финальный результат.
Но почему бы не использовать в качестве дополнительной фишки для SVP. madVR, например, ни Video Enhancer, ни NNEDI3 не использует. Значит, можно сразу в скрипте ресайзить картинку до разрешения экрана и назвать как-нибудь - супер-мега качественный улучшайзер )
Или NNEDI3 слишком медленный и для рельного времени не катит?

Про Video Enhancer вообще первый раз услышал

11 (edited by gaunt 06-04-2011 12:41:58)

Re: MVTools2 и все-все-все

Noweol wrote:

Значит, можно сразу в скрипте ресайзить картинку до разрешения экрана и назвать как-нибудь - супер-мега качественный улучшайзер

Давно пытаюсь "донести" - всё что меньше размера экрана - сначала в размер , затем обработка .

Re: MVTools2 и все-все-все

gaunt wrote:

чтоенье

вот что это было за слово?
а ресайз до размера экрана уже есть - скрытый параметр AllowUpsize=1 отключает проверку на апсайз в окне профиля

Re: MVTools2 и все-все-все

Rimsky wrote:

а ресайз до размера экрана уже есть - скрытый параметр AllowUpsize=1 отключает проверку на апсайз в окне профиля

Так то оно так , да не так .
Приводить к разрешению экрана любое видео - качественно приводить , не копаясь в настройках , доступно из интерфейса .
За "чтоенье" извиняюсь , отвлекли ...

14 (edited by Noweol 06-04-2011 12:48:47)

Re: MVTools2 и все-все-все

Rimsky wrote:

а ресайз до размера экрана уже есть - скрытый параметр AllowUpsize=1 отключает проверку на апсайз в окне профиля

Но выбора алгоритма скалинга нет ) Как нет выбора резайзить до разрешения до повышения плавности или уже после?

15 (edited by Rimsky 06-04-2011 13:03:33)

Re: MVTools2 и все-все-все

еще раз: AllowUpsize=1 отключает проверку на апсайз в окне профиля для настройки "Уменьшение размера кадра"
Уменьшает/увеличивает до уплавнения
Алгоритм по результатам исследований был выбран LanczosResize (сейчас подсмотрел в скрипте)

пишу по памяти, так что могу и соврать. На форуме не нашел описаловок, что есть минус

Re: MVTools2 и все-все-все

пишу по памяти, так что могу и соврать. На форуме не нашел описаловок, что есть минус

Ну так зачем прятать очевидное ? Сейчас нагрузка на камень , в случае гпу построения - ниже плинтуса , вполне уменьшить еще . Но проблем с рендерами меньше не стало : то дропы , то потеря верт. синхронизации . Если избавиться от ресайза силами видеокарты - системный рендер решит все проблемы

17 (edited by Noweol 07-04-2011 04:21:48)

Re: MVTools2 и все-все-все

BicubicResize 0,7 был выбран за удовлетворительное качество при быстрой работе. Что, собственно, правда. Но у вышеперечисленных алгоритмов качество выше всех похвал.
Так что предложение на следующую бету: желающим

, у кого комп позволяет,
сравнить, есть ли выигрыш при апскалинге до плавности. Всё таки речь идёт о повышении точности всего на несколько пикселей туда-сюда.
Добавить пару алгоритмов на выбор softcubic 50
(откуда-то этот алгоритм взяли для madVR - сейчас у меня основным стоит и нравится)
, bicubic 0,7, lanzcos 3, NNEDI3 и Video Enhancer.
И галку: "реcайз до/после плавности".

Re: MVTools2 и все-все-все

EEDI2 produces better results for this purpose than NNEDI2 or NNEDI3 (both ABS and non-ABS).
It is very slow, so it is only used in the Placebo preset smile

Re: MVTools2 и все-все-все

SubJunk
Do you know anything about "Video Enhancer"? Is it faster?

Re: MVTools2 и все-все-все

I haven't tried it since it is paid after 30 days.
Anyway the benefits of using a custom pelclip are only slight, I wouldn't worry about it too much smile

Re: MVTools2 и все-все-все

Вышла MVTools 2.5.11.3

2.5.11.3 (19.09.2011 by Fizick)
- MFlowInter: исправлен planar.
- MCompensate: исправлен деструктор для recursion

Документация и загрузка MVTools2